Don’t skip browning the beef—it adds deep flavor. Layer vegetables according to cooking time: hearty ones (carrots, celery) go in first, tender ones (zucchini, peas) later. For a thicker soup, mash some cooked vegetables against the side of the slow cooker or stir in a cornstarch slurry (1 tablespoon cornstarch mixed with 2 tablespoons cold water) at the end. Let the soup rest on warm for 30 minutes after cooking for even better flavor.
